  • Mazda RX-8 -- Detail For A Friend

    My buddy just bought this RX-8 as an extra, for fun, car. He wanted the paint corrected and protected. He also wanted the interior cleaned and detailed. This won't be a daily driver and will always be garaged. He just wanted to make it look sweet and get it ready for summer.


    Here is what I used:

    Wheels & Wheel Wells

    Amazing Roll Off -- tires, and wheel wells
    Meguiar's Wheel Brightner -- rims

    Wash

    Dawn Dishwashing Soap.....

    Engine

    Amazing Roll Off
    Dressed with 303 Aerospace Protectant

    Carpets

    Folex -- spot treatment
    Pro-Form (Sams Club) Carpet Cleaner -- Cleaning
    Bissell

    Leather

    Clean -- Woolite 10:1
    Condition -- Meguiar's Leather Cleaner & Conditioner (just got it!)

    Interior and Door Jams

    Meguiars APC+ 4:1
    Plastic & Dash treated with 303
    Alcohol & Water 50/50 for windows
    Also treated all of the rubber seals with 303 Protectant

    Paint

    Klasse AIO w/ white CCS pad
    Collinite 845 w/ Grey CCS pad

                Re: Mazda RX-8 -- Detail For A Friend

                So Dawn works better than any high quality soap at removing wax? Without damaging paint?

                Comment


                • #9
                  Re: Mazda RX-8 -- Detail For A Friend

                  Originally posted by rosario02 View Post
                  So Dawn works better than any high quality soap at removing wax? Without damaging paint?
                  A quality car wash soap won't remove your wax at all, but Dawn (or any other grease cutting detergent) sure will. But with regular use it will also start to degrade vinyl, rubber and plastic trim and even start to dry out the paint. For a once a year routine it's probably OK, but even then it isn't necessary.
                  Michael Stoops
                  Senior Global Product & Training Specialist | Meguiar's Inc.
